Open Source Software has been around for many years.  Open Source components have been used to develop library systems since the late 1990’s.  Koha, acknowledged as the first fully open source library system was launched by its New Zealand based developers in 2000.   The growing interest around open source, stimulated by Koha, was given a significant boost when Georgia Public Libraries launched Evergreen in September 2006.
